What the ms office invoice template for facilities is and why it matters

A ms office invoice template for facilities is a standardized Microsoft Office document configured to record charges, labor, materials, and billing details specific to facility management activities. It combines fixed fields for vendor and client data, customizable line-item tables for labor and parts, tax and discount calculations, and space for purchase order or work order references. Using a consistent template reduces errors, accelerates approvals, and provides a clear audit record for accounts payable and facilities teams. Templates can be reused, edited, or integrated with electronic signature and document storage systems to complete the invoicing lifecycle.

Common challenges when managing facility invoices

  • Inconsistent field formats across vendors causing delays in invoice validation and duplicate work between departments.
  • Missing purchase order or work order references that block automated matching and extend payment cycles.
  • Manual line-item entry for labor and parts that increases human error and creates mismatched totals.
  • Limited tracking of approvals and signatures leading to unclear responsibility and slow resolution of disputes.

Typical user roles and responsibilities

Facilities Manager

Oversees maintenance and service work, provides work order references, and verifies billed labor and materials against completed tasks. Responsible for approving invoices or escalating discrepancies to procurement or accounting for resolution.

Accounts Payable Clerk

Receives invoices, matches them to purchase orders or work orders, enters or imports data into the accounting system, and processes payments following approval. Maintains records for audit and tax purposes.

Core template features that improve accuracy and traceability

Use templates with dedicated features to reduce errors and enable easier integration with accounting and asset systems.

Custom Fields

Create fields for work order, asset tag, vendor contract ID, and site location to standardize data capture and support automated matching to procurement records and asset inventories.

Line Item Tables

Structured tables for labor, parts, unit rates, and totals allow precise calculations, enable tax and discount logic, and produce clearer audit trails for cost allocation across facilities.

Pre-built Calculations

Include formulas for tax, discounts, and subtotal calculations to reduce manual spreadsheet errors and ensure invoice totals are consistent with accounting rules and contract terms.

Template Library

Maintain centrally managed templates for different service types and contract classes so teams use the correct format and reduce versioning issues across multiple properties or sites.

Best practices for secure and accurate facility invoicing

Adopt standard controls and review procedures to keep invoice processing efficient, compliant, and auditable.

Mandate required fields before submission
Configure the template to require PO numbers, work order IDs, vendor tax IDs, and site codes to prevent incomplete invoices and ensure reliable automated matching with purchase orders and general ledger accounts.
Use version-controlled templates in a central repository
Store templates in a managed document library with access controls to prevent unauthorized edits, preserve approved formats, and ensure everyone uses the most current invoice format.
Integrate signatures and approval chains
Incorporate electronic signature steps and predefined approval sequences so facilities managers and AP reviewers can sign and approve invoices securely without manual print-and-scan steps.
Retain full audit trails for each invoice
Capture timestamps, user IDs, and action histories for every change, approval, and signature to support audits, dispute resolution, and compliance reporting.
